Vetwest Animal Hospitals Carine (Duncraig) Vetwest Animal Hospitals Carine (Duncraig)12 Davallia RoadCarine Glades Professional CentreDuncraig WA 6023 AustraliaPhone: (08) 9404 1133Url: https://www.vetwest.com.au/locations/carine-duncraig-vet/